Overview
The Women in STEM Scholarship provides up to $2,500 per recipient to support women in Alberta pursuing post-secondary studies in science, technology, engineering, and mathematics fields where women are underrepresented. The program aims to advance gender equality and empowers eligible women to further their education in STEM disciplines.
Financing terms and conditions
- A total of $125,000 is available for the scholarship program.
- Each successful applicant will receive $2,500 in funding for their studies.
- Fifty (50) women will be awarded funding for the 2025-26 academic year.

Eligibility
- The applicant must identify as a woman.
- The applicant must be studying in a STEM (science, technology, engineering, or mathematics) program as defined by Statistics Canada.
- The applicant must be a Canadian citizen, Permanent Resident, or Protected Person.
- The applicant must be a resident of Alberta under specific residency requirements.
- The applicant must be registered (full or part-time) at an approved post-secondary institution located in Alberta, including recognized apprenticeship programs.

How to apply
1
Register for a GATE account
- Request a GATE username and password during the scholarship's open intake period
- Click on the "Request an account" button to register
- Do not send an email requesting a login
- The username and password will be sent to your email within 2 business days
2
Complete and submit application
- Log in to the GATE system with your received username and password
- Complete the online application form
- Provide all required information and documentation
Additional information
- Intake for the 2025-26 academic year is open from September 15 to October 31, 2025.
- Previous recipients may reapply; however, priority is given to those who have not previously received the scholarship.
- Applicants may apply to multiple scholarships (Women in STEM, Persons Case, Women in Technical and Applied Arts), but can only receive one in the same calendar year.
